Saint Andrew's chapel is a chapel located in the village of Kos, Slovakia. The building is believed to have been finished in 1409. At present, in the region of Prievidza, there is a developed mining industry of lignite and brown coal which influences the environment in the area. Unfortunately, the chapel was situated in one of the undermined parts of the village and was endangered. That is why the representatives of the regional restoration atelier of the Monumental institute in Banská Bystrica decided to save this historical building. A unique transport in the Slovak history was planned and the 400 tonne heavy chapel was transported using wheeled transporter borrowed from Germany on December 6, 2000. It is now situated in another part of Kos which is not undermined.
